New Delhi, Oct. 29 -- Adani Green Energy, the renewable energy arm of the Adani Group, saw its shares jump 14% in early trade on Wednesday, October 29, hitting a one-month high of Rs.1,145. The rally came as a reaction to the company's September quarter numbers, which beat Street estimates, also helping end the stock's three-day losing streak.
The company announced the numbers post-market hours on Tuesday. Though revenue largely stayed flat, higher energy sales and operational efficiency led to a 25% YoY jump in consolidated net profit to Rs.644 crore.
